identifikator: 20040501
Guest
Sat Oct 23, 2010 4:02 pm
czy w wincuplu można stosować zmienne pośrednie, które nie są przypisane do
pinów, a używane tylko w tworzeniu opisu logiki?
identifikator: 20040501
Guest
Sat Oct 23, 2010 4:04 pm
Quote:
czy w wincuplu można stosować zmienne pośrednie, które nie są przypisane
do pinów, a używane tylko w tworzeniu opisu logiki?
widział gdzieś Ktoś opis sposobu symulacji zaprojektowanego układu?
jest opis do tworzenia równań, ale nie ma w nim opisu symulacji...
Artur M. Piwko
Guest
Mon Oct 25, 2010 7:57 am
In the darkest hour on Sat, 23 Oct 2010 18:04:06 +0200,
identifikator: 20040501 <NOSPAMtestowanije@go2.pl> screamed:
Quote:
czy w wincuplu można stosować zmienne pośrednie, które nie są przypisane
do pinów, a używane tylko w tworzeniu opisu logiki?
widział gdzieś Ktoś opis sposobu symulacji zaprojektowanego układu?
jest opis do tworzenia równań, ale nie ma w nim opisu symulacji...
Dawne to były czasy ale WinCUPL umiał testować i/o z testowego pliku,
który mu się podało.
--
[ Artur M. Piwko : Pipen : AMP29-RIPE : RLU:100918 : From == Trap! : SIG:218B ]
[ 09:57:15 user up 12601 days, 21:52, 1 user, load average: 0.13, 0.61, 0.09 ]
Books: You can't grep dead trees.
J.F.
Guest
Mon Oct 25, 2010 10:29 am
On Sat, 23 Oct 2010 18:04:06 +0200, identifikator: 20040501 wrote:
Quote:
czy w wincuplu można stosować zmienne pośrednie, które nie są przypisane
do pinów, a używane tylko w tworzeniu opisu logiki?
spojrzalem we wlasne starocie - najwyrazniej mozna.
Choc CUPL jest wrazliwy jak przedwojenna panienka z dobrego domu -
nigdy nie wiadomo na co ci pozwoli i jak wykona.
Quote:
widział gdzieś Ktoś opis sposobu symulacji zaprojektowanego układu?
jest opis do tworzenia równań, ale nie ma w nim opisu symulacji...
Bylo w ktoryms pliku, a ogolnie - tworzysz tekstowy plik .si
Device G20V8;
ORDER:
EMUL3..0,%4,!ROM_CS,!ROM_OE,!ROM_WE,%4,
!DBUF_EN,!DBUF_RD,%2,!ABUF_EN,!ABUF_RD,%4,!RAM_OE,!RAM_WE ;
VECTORS:
$msg "czytanie RAM";
011X XXX H* H* LH
$MSG "ZAPIS RAM";
0101 XXX H* H* HH
itd.
$msg sa dla ciebie - znajda sie w pliku wynikowym,
0, 1, X - wymuszenie stanu na wejsciach,
H,L - sprawdzenie stanu na wyjsciach, * - stan dowolny.
J.